CUCM version is 10.5.2. I have created a new region and have done intra & inter region configuration. Now the new region has configuration that affects the existing regions (like max bit rate between the new region & the old regions). I have assigned this new region to a new device pool. Existing regions has its own device pools and there are hundreds of devices in the existing device pools. New region needs to be reset for the configuration to take effect.
My question is - if I reset the new region, what will be the impact. Will it affect the existing devices in the existing device pools. I would like to confirm as this system is in production.

To make it little more clear....
Reg1 --> DP1 --> Device1
Reg2 --> DP2 --> Device2
Reg1 is configured as follows -
within Reg1 - Default audio codec preference list, 64kbps for audio, 384kbps for video, 32256kbps for immersive
Reg1 to Reg2 - Default audio codec preference list, 128kbps for audio, 384kbps for video, 6000kbps for immersive
My question is - if I reset Reg1 (only the region not the DP), will it impact/reset Device2 (in DP2 --> Region2).
Thanks in advance.
03-18-2015 03:15 AM
If you reset Reg1 , the devices associated to only Region1 will restart . The devices associated to other region will not be impacted.
In your case Device1 will reset and Device2 will not.
